微信公众号搜"智元新知"关注
微信扫一扫可直接关注哦!

为什么红黑树在Linux上优先于AVL树进行内存pipe理?

用于链接内存映射可执行文件的各个部分的vm_area_struct结构存储为红黑树。 现在,据我所知,这里的post也提到红黑树和AVL树之间的区别 AVL树比RB树执行更快的查找。

此树由进程引用的虚拟地址build立索引,并在进程开始执行时创build。 我期望这棵树被大量地用于查找,有时候用于插入和删除。 如果情况是这样的话,那么为什么AVL树不能优先于RB树作为实现呢?

另外,如果我的理解不正确,并且树涉及大量的插入和删除,与查找相比,请提供参考来支持这个声明。

我曾经看过一些关于tldp的文章,提到早期的AVL树也被用到了。 请解释这个变化是什么原因引起的?

任何工具/软件在Linux / Ubuntu的微软“JouleMeter”相当于

有没有办法在Minix 3中访问和修改系统调用用户数据? 我可以在这里使用sys_datacopy()吗? 为什么我的尝试不工作?

linux内核一步一步

如何编写自定义模块的ebtables?

如何使用Linux获得触摸屏Rawdata的坐标

如何实现x86 linux的GPIO中断处理程序?

sys / types.h:没有这样的文件或目录

Linux Uart驱动程序修改

我不明白Windows IRQL

有用的Linux内核debugging选项打开

版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。

相关推荐